Output 6c62866fcf5ce285d3b96858365e6880ca06bc4ab75969069ae62fe0ae6a68ee:23

value
4100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f8e188e012ef6488921a4628e1fafb4f778318 OP_EQUAL
address
36RpXt6a57YiHTRrPiZRY4ZiFD2qdHpf3e
transaction
6c62866fcf5ce285d3b96858365e6880ca06bc4ab75969069ae62fe0ae6a68ee
spent
true